Russian Defense: HIMARS battery neutralized and two Ukrainian planes shot down

Russian forces destroyed the HIMARS launcher battery, struck the M777 howitzer battery produced in the US, and downed two MiG-24 and MiG-29 aircraft of the Ukrainian Air Force.
The Russian Ministry of Defense made this announcement on Thursday, September 29, as part of its daily update on progress.

Igor Konashenkov, the ministry’s spokesperson, read out the statement. He went on to say that the Russian Armed Forces are still engaged in a special military operation in Ukraine and that they have bombed the “Foreign Legion” of foreign mercenary units near the village of “Nikolaevka” in the Donetsk People’s Republic and neutralised up to 80 of their armed members.

Additionally, a firing at the temporary deployment location of the 2nd battalion of the 92nd Mechanized Brigade of the Ukrainian Armed Forces close to the city of Kobyansk in the Kharkov region resulted in the neutralisation of more than 70 Ukrainian servicemen and 14 pieces of military equipment.

Six command posts of the Ukrainian Armed Forces were also hit during the past 24 hours by strikes made by operational and tactical aviation, missile forces, and artillery, including the command posts of the 53rd Mechanized Brigade near the village of “Yelizavetovka” in the Donetsk People’s Republic and the brigade Mechanic No.

14, in addition to 87 units and centres of concentration of military people and gear in 198 districts, are located near the village of “Dvorechnaya” in the Kharkov region.
The US HIMARS battery was destroyed during the anti-missile combat in the Pavlograd village of the Dnipropetrovsk area, and the US M777 howitzer battery was also hit close to the village of “Gulyaipule” in the Zaporozhye region.

In the Donetsk People’s Republic settlement of Yevgenovka, a platoon of large-caliber Gyatsent cannons was destroyed by artillery fire.
The villages of “Kolomtsevo” in the Dnipropetrovsk region, “Shevchenkovo” in the Nikolaev region, “Legino” in the Zaporozhye region, as well as “Kramotorsk” and “Malinovka” in the Donetsk People’s Republic, also saw the destruction of nine ammunition, missile, and artillery depots.

In the Nikolaev region, a radar station for the Ukrainian S-300 anti-aircraft missile group was also destroyed.
A Ukrainian MiG-29 fighter and a Russian Su-24 aircraft were both shot down by the Russian Aerospace Forces in the vicinity of Kurakhovo and Kaluga, respectively, in the Donetsk People’s Republic.

Additionally, eight drones were destroyed by the air defence systems in the villages of “Alexandrovka” in the Nikolaev region, “Proskinskoye”, “Rayskoye”, and “Sadok” in the Kherson region, “Yasinivka” in the Lugansk People’s Republic, and “Pavlovka” and “Petrovskoye” in the Donetsk People’s Republic.
Additionally, 17 US HIMARS launchers as well as a US anti-radar Harm missile were shot down in the skies near the Kherson region’s “Novaya Kakhovka” town and the capital city of Kherson.
